Ohio Rev. Code Ann. § 307.20

Powers over air navigation facilities

Applied in 1 court decision — leading case City of Heath v. Licking County Regional Airport Authority (1967)

Most recently applied in City of Heath v. Licking County Regional Airport Authority (September 1967)

Effective: October 13, 1965; Latest Legislation: Senate Bill 166 - 106th General Assembly

The board of county commissioners, in addition to its other powers, shall have the same authority, subject to the same limitations, with respect to airports, landing fields, and other air navigation facilities as is conferred upon municipal corporations by sections 717.01 and 719.01 of the Revised Code and may operate thereon public recreation facilities and public parks. The board of county commissioners may contract with any person, firm, or corporation to operate restaurants, parking lots, motels, gasoline service stations, public parks, office buildings, retail stores for merchandising or services, and industrial uses on airports, landing fields, and other air navigation facilities.

"Airport," "landing field," and "air navigation facility," as defined in section 4561.01 of the Revised Code, apply to this section.
